About the Position
As a Senior Electrical Engineer in the Oil & Gas group, you will be responsible for performing engineering design and analysis under the responsible charge of a Professional Engineer in a manner that provides the client with a quality deliverable that is on time and within budget.
This opportunity is only available to candidates located within the Odessa/Midland, TX area. Candidates can work remotely from this geographical location.
Essential Responsibilities
- Perform detailed design of all aspects of electrical power systems to include one-line diagrams, three-line diagrams, control and relaying schematics, wiring diagrams, SCADA, communications, conduit and cable sizing/routing, grounding design, general arrangement, selection of equipment, writing of equipment specifications, project and construction cost estimates, and project scheduling as they relate to Substations and other power projects
- Prepare computer-based models and perform power system studies on utility and industrial/commercial electrical power transmission and distribution systems, including short circuit, load flow, relay coordination, arc flash, motor starting, power factor, harmonic analysis and other related studies. Employee should create a simple hand check to quantify the computer aided results.
- Develop protective relay settings. Set, test, wire, and install relaying and control systems.

Must Have
- Education: Bachelor’s in Electrical Engineering or Electrical Engineering Technology from an accredited institution, electric power option preferred
- Experience: 7+ years of relevant engineering or field experience
- Licensure: FE is required; PE preferred
- Knowledge and familiarity with medium and low voltage distribution
- Base knowledge of Protection & Control Schemes
- Knowledge and familiarity with substation electrical design
- Proficiency with power system studies software such as PSSE, PSCAD, ETAP, SKM
